A guaranteed fun space for the kidsThis beautiful neoclassical building of white marble was constructed in 1904. It houses the Rhode Island general assembly, the offices of the governor, the lieutenant governor, Secretary of State and the general treasurer. Can keep your kids busy for daysThis prestigious cemetery, established in 1846, has spread incrementally from 60 acres to over 200 acres in the present day. So many important historical figures and dignitaries have been interred here that it has become listed on the National Register of Historic Places. Perfect for kids day out in ProvidenceBuilt as a men's basketball indoor arena, this facility constructed in 1972 has gone on to become a multi-purpose Center used for everything from hockey, wrestling, to concerts, Comic Cons and conventions.
